The Link Between Safety and Thought

The brain is not separate from the body. It is part of the same system.

When the nervous system senses threat — even subtle, chronic stress — mental energy is diverted toward vigilance. Thoughts become repetitive. Focus narrows. Creativity contracts.

The body’s state determines the mind’s capacity.

  • Tight muscles signal ongoing alertness
  • Shallow breathing reduces oxygen flow
  • Elevated heart rate increases mental agitation
  • Chronic tension fragments attention

When the body feels unsafe, the mind remains preoccupied with protection.

Clarity requires calm.

The Nervous System as the Gatekeeper of Clarity

The nervous system constantly assesses whether you are safe or under threat. This assessment happens beneath awareness, shaping how you think and feel.

When the body shifts into rest, cognitive resources become available again.

  • Slow, steady breathing stabilises the system
  • Warm, reassuring touch reduces hypervigilance
  • Consistent rhythm signals predictability
  • Grounded presence lowers defensive activation

In tantric sensual massage, touch becomes a communication of safety. The body responds before the mind understands.

As the system settles, mental fog begins to lift.

Breath as the Bridge to Mental Ease

Breath reflects internal safety.

When anxious or overstimulated, breath shortens and rises into the chest. When safe, it deepens and slows naturally.

In sensual tantric practice, breath is gently supported without instruction or force.

  • Slow strokes encourage longer exhalations
  • Hands resting on the ribs invite expansion
  • Pauses allow breath to settle
  • Synchronised rhythm steadies internal tempo

As breath deepens, oxygen flow improves. Muscles soften. The mind receives the signal that vigilance is no longer required.

Clarity often follows the first deep, unforced breath.

Releasing Physical Tension to Free Mental Space

Physical tension consumes mental energy.

Holding the shoulders tight, clenching the jaw, or bracing the abdomen requires subtle effort. This effort occupies the nervous system continuously.

When tension releases, energy is freed.

  • Softening the neck reduces cognitive strain
  • Relaxing the jaw lowers subconscious stress
  • Releasing the abdomen deepens breath
  • Unwinding the hips stabilises posture

These shifts may feel physical, yet their impact is cognitive. The mind becomes less burdened.

When the body relaxes, thinking becomes simpler.
